Description: A creamy sauce with a perfect blend of fresh basil and roasted red peppers (especially good in summer when basil is in season). Kids and adults will both love it. Pairs well with zucchini and/or chicken either on the side or mixed into the pasta.
Ingredients:
2 cups penne pasta
1/4 cup milk
4 ounces cream cheese, softened
10 ounces roasted red peppers, packed in oil
3/4 cup fresh basil leaf
2 tablespoons parmesan cheese, grated
Steps:
Cook pasta according to package directions, drain and set aside.
Drain and remove seeds from peppers.
In a food processor (or blender), mix peppers, cream cheese, milk, basil and parmesan until smooth, about 1 minute.
Place sauce back into same pot used for cooking pasta.
Cook on medium heat for 5 minutes, stirring occassionally or until heated through.
Add pasta back into pot with sauce, toss well to coat.
